Performance Program Manager

Job in Romeoville, Will County, Illinois, 60446, USA

The Performance Program Manager will be responsible for building the operating rhythm that turns cross-functional performance data into routine management action. Reporting into Planning & Performance Management leadership, this role will partner with operational stakeholders across the business to define KPI-based performance routines, shepherd the creation of the underlying reports and dashboards, facilitate recurring review sessions, and support ad hoc analysis tied to escalations, root-cause work, and priority initiatives.

Success will be measured by whether the team has consistent, decision-oriented routines in place, whether reporting is timely and trusted, whether escalations and initiatives are supported with clear analysis, and whether leaders are using the routines to drive faster issue resolution and stronger cross-functional accountability.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ities
  • Partner with operational stakeholders across the business to define, build, and maintain KPI-based performance routines across key workflows and functions.
  • Stand up and facilitate weekly and monthly performance management routines that convert recurring misses, escalations, and operational trends into action, ownership, and follow-through.
  • Shepherd the creation, refinement, and standardization of reports, dashboards, scorecards, and recurring metrics needed to support operating reviews.
  • Prepare materials for recurring business reviews, structure issue discussions, capture actions, and follow up on commitments to support routine management discipline.
  • Support ad hoc analysis related to escalations, root-cause investigations, operational initiatives, and leadership priorities.
  • Translate fragmented operational information into clear management insight and decision support.
  • Help standardize KPI definitions, reporting logic, and data sources so stakeholders are working from consistent and trusted information.
  • Identify gaps in reporting, data quality, or management cadence and work with stakeholders to improve them.
  • Incorporate AI-enabled tools thoughtfully into analysis, reporting workflows, meeting preparation, and insight generation in ways that improve speed, quality, and consistency while maintaining sound judgment and data integrity.
  • Support leaders in moving from reactive issue handling to structured, data-backed performance management routines.
Knowledge, Skills, And Abilities
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to organize data, identify patterns and trends, and communicate business implications clearly.
  • Experience building or supporting dashboards, scorecards, KPI reporting, and recurring business review materials.
  • Strong meeting facilitation and follow-up discipline, with the ability to help teams maintain action-oriented routines and clear accountability.
  • Proficiency in Excel and experience working with BI and reporting tools.
  • Comfort working across multiple stakeholder groups and translating between operational teams and leadership needs.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to present findings, frame issues, and summarize actions clearly.
  • Demonstrated curiosity and problem-solving ability in support of escalations, root-cause work, and priority initiatives.
  • Ability and willingness to incorporate AI-enabled tools into day-to-day work in a practical and responsible manner to improve analysis, reporting efficiency, and operating rigor.
Education and Experience
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Business, Analytics, Supply Chain, Operations, Finance, Engineering, or a related field required; equivalent practical experience may be considered.
  • 4+ years of experience in analytics, business operations, supply chain analysis, logistics analysis, or a related role.
  • Experience building or supporting dashboards, scorecards, KPI reporting, or recurring management review materials.
  • Experience supporting cross‑functional stakeholders in operations, logistics, warehousing, transportation, or supply‑chain environment preferred.
  • Familiarity with Power BI, Tableau, SQL, or other reporting and query tools preferred.
